Description
It's the best I could come up with given current rumours
Arvidsson has been seen as the potential replacement to Hyman and Nashville are listening to offers on him and Nashville and Toronto were in convos over Filip Forberg this past season as well..
Andersen coming back is more or less a surprise? But he needs to come back at a low hit for it to work? 2-2.5 for 1 or 2 seasons should do the trick?
Rielly might have to be sacrificed and I threw Engvall in the trade because I don't mind him leaving and ship Rielly off to a team that needs offensive help on their blue line and also have holes to fill in their d core. Gurianov would be another great winger pickup whose miles better than Mikhayev and can hold down a Top 6 role if it was given to him. Mikhayev stays. Bozak Returns to Toronto, So does Foligno and that becomes a really good shut down 3rd line imo. Robertson is the healthy scratch to be placed in if the team needs more offense. To replace Rielly's spot the Leafs sign Oleksiak to a lower cap for longer term. Muzzin becomes the top LHD in Toronto. Oleksiak plays alongside Holl. Sandin plays alongside a Returning Bogosian. Imo the team becomes more balanced. Offensively capable Offense with Defensively capable defence. Muzzin Brodie is a great shutdown pair. Oleksiak and Holl would be as well! Oleksiak is a master of shutting down off rush chances. Sandin and Bogosian I think needed more time to get adjusted but they will be great together!
Mcelhinney returns as a 3rd goalie.
Del Zotto comes aboard being good friends with JT.
I did have Sam Gagner as well but decided against it?
I believe this team has been constructed more reasonably than other teams? People are still going to disagree with it but I feel like if Dubas was going in a certain direction he'd probably go this route?
